Join TrustPoint and Build the World's First Commercial GPS System in Space GPS is a ubiquitous global utility in modern society; knowing one's location is critical for government, commercial, and personal applications. Still, today's solutions for determining location are inaccurate, slow, unencrypted, and susceptible to jamming and spoofing. These shortcomings make GPS insufficient for tomorrow's safety-critical and high-precision applications, a problem TrustPoint intends to solve. TrustPoint is developing a fully commercial next-generation GPS service to provide significant performance, security and reliability improvements for GPS users. This includes better accuracy, quicker Time to First Fix, and anti-spoof and anti-jam capabilities. The improvements will support US Government position and timing service resiliency as well as enable next-generation commercial applications like drone delivery, self-driving cars, urban air mobility, and augmented reality. The $55B annual GNSS Receiver market is ripe for disruption and TrustPoint intends to lead that revolution with our commercial infrastructure and services.
